Senate Megabill Stuns the Clean Energy Industry With New Tax on Wind and Solar – WSJ

The clean energy industry is reeling after the Senate introduced a megabill that imposes a new tax on wind and solar projects. The surprise move threatens to cripple renewable energy initiatives and could impact projects nationwide, including seven school projects in Massachusetts.

Key Takeaways:

  • The Senate’s megabill introduces a new tax on wind and solar energy projects.
  • The clean energy industry is stunned by the sudden tax, which may cripple renewable initiatives.
  • Seven Massachusetts school solar projects could be affected by incentive cuts.
  • The bill hastens the end of existing tax credits for wind and solar power.
  • The measure is described as a ‘kill shot’ targeting renewable energy projects.

A Surprise Tax on Wind and Solar

The Senate has unveiled a megabill that includes a new tax on wind and solar energy projects. This unexpected move has sent shockwaves through the clean energy industry. According to reports, the “G.O.P. Bill Adds Surprise Tax That Could Cripple Wind and Solar Power.”

Industry Reaction: Stunned and Concerned

The clean energy sector is grappling with the implications of this legislative development. Industry leaders express deep concern that the new tax could severely hamper renewable energy initiatives across the country. One commentator described the situation as a “‘Kill shot’: GOP megabill targets solar, wind projects with new tax.”

Impact on Massachusetts School Projects

The repercussions of the bill are already being felt at the local level. “Solar incentive cuts could hit 7 Mass. school projects, US senators say,” highlighting the immediate effects on community initiatives. These projects were relying on existing incentives to implement sustainable energy solutions for schools.

Hastening the End of Renewable Tax Credits

In addition to imposing a new tax, the bill accelerates the expiration of existing tax credits for wind and solar power. “Senate bill hastens end of wind, solar tax credits and imposes new tax,” further intensifying the challenges faced by the renewable energy sector.

A Critical Moment for Clean Energy

The introduction of this tax represents a significant hurdle for the advancement of clean energy in the United States. With the potential to cripple ongoing and future projects, stakeholders are urging a re-examination of the bill’s provisions to prevent long-term damage to the industry.
